首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么shift/alt键盘组合适用于默认绑定,而不适用于我的自定义绑定?(VS代码)

在VS代码中,shift/alt键盘组合适用于默认绑定,而不适用于自定义绑定的原因可能是由于以下几个方面:

  1. 快捷键冲突:在VS代码中,可能存在多个默认绑定的快捷键使用了shift/alt键盘组合。当你尝试自定义绑定时,如果与默认绑定的快捷键冲突,系统会优先执行默认绑定,而不会触发你的自定义绑定。
  2. 缺乏唯一标识:自定义绑定需要一个唯一的标识来识别该绑定,以便在按下相应的键盘组合时执行相应的操作。如果你的自定义绑定没有提供一个唯一的标识,系统就无法正确地识别并执行你的绑定。
  3. 键盘布局差异:shift/alt键盘组合的适用性可能受到不同键盘布局的影响。如果你的键盘布局与默认绑定所适用的键盘布局不同,那么你的自定义绑定可能无法正确地触发。

针对以上问题,你可以尝试以下解决方案:

  1. 检查快捷键冲突:在VS代码的设置中,搜索并查看默认绑定的快捷键列表,确保你的自定义绑定不会与已有的快捷键冲突。如果存在冲突,可以尝试修改自定义绑定或选择其他未被使用的快捷键。
  2. 提供唯一标识:在自定义绑定时,确保为每个绑定提供一个唯一的标识,以便系统能够正确地识别并执行你的绑定。可以使用特定的键盘符号或其他独特的标识来区分不同的绑定。
  3. 考虑键盘布局:如果你的键盘布局与默认绑定所适用的键盘布局不同,可以尝试调整键盘布局设置,使其与默认绑定的键盘布局一致。这样可以提高自定义绑定的适用性。

需要注意的是,以上解决方案可能并非适用于所有情况,具体还需要根据你的自定义绑定和环境进行调整。如果问题仍然存在,你可以参考VS代码的官方文档或社区论坛,寻求更详细的帮助和支持。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云官网:https://cloud.tencent.com/
  • 云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 云数据库 MySQL 版:https://cloud.tencent.com/product/cdb_mysql
  • 人工智能平台(AI Lab):https://cloud.tencent.com/product/ailab
  • 云存储(COS):https://cloud.tencent.com/product/cos
  • 区块链服务(BCS):https://cloud.tencent.com/product/bcs
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

VS Code(​终端)

在命令面板(Ctrl + Shift + P)中,使用“ 查看:切换集成终端”命令。 注意:如果您想在VS Code之外工作,仍可以使用Ctrl + Shift + C键盘快捷键打开外壳。...以下是可在集成终端中快速导航键盘快捷键: 键 命令 Ctrl +` 显示集成终端 Ctrl + Shift +` 创建新终端 Ctrl + Alt + PageUp 向上滚动 Ctrl + Alt +...有一个硬编码命令列表,这些命令跳过了外壳程序处理,而是发送到VS Code绑定系统。您可以使用terminal.integrated.commandsToSkipShell设置来自定义此列表。...终端中和弦键绑定 默认情况下,当和弦快捷键是最高优先级快捷键时,它将始终跳过终端外壳(绕过terminal.integrated.commandsToSkipShell),并由VS Code不是终端进行评估...请注意,该命令仅适用于\u0000通过字符代码使用字符格式(不适用于\x00)。

3.4K20

Visual Studio 2008 每日提示(二十三)

vs为什么没有设置地方呢?....前进”绑定快捷键Alt+右方向键 ,这两个命令在其他地方使用,也可以在对象浏览器使用。...注意:自动为黑色,默认是蓝色。自动从操作系统窗口文字前景继承 此时,改变windows主题,比如把窗口文字改成浅绿。 再看“可见空白”项自动变成了浅绿,默认仍然是蓝色。...因此,自动取决windows 操作系统设置,默认则是vs默认设置,这个默认设置依赖.vssettings文件中第一启动设置或者最后一次重置后.vssettings文件。...你可以默认设置迅速复位。 评论:作者测试工作真是做非常细致。这么细节地方你注意了么?

1.1K60

v-on绑定一系列事件修饰符

因此, v-on:click.prevent.self 会阻止所有的点击, v-on:click.self.prevent 只会阻止对元素自身点击。...请记住,.passive 会告诉浏览器你不想阻止事件默认行为。 按键修饰符 在监听键盘事件时,我们经常需要检查详细按键。Vue 允许为 v-on 在监听键盘事件时添加按键修饰符: <!...你还可以通过全局 config.keyCodes 对象自定义按键修饰符别名: // 可以使用 `v-on:keyup.f1` Vue.config.keyCodes.f1 = 112 系统修饰键 可以如下修饰符来实现仅在按下相应按键时才触发鼠标或键盘事件监听器....ctrl .alt .shift .meta 注意:在 Mac 系统键盘上,meta 对应 command 键 (⌘)。...因为你无须在 JavaScript 里手动绑定事件,你 ViewModel 代码可以是非常纯粹逻辑,和 DOM 完全解耦,更易于测试。

2.1K10

VSCode10个巧妙技巧

VS Code Speech 扩展允许你通过按 Ctrl-Alt-V(或你选择其他键绑定)直接在编辑器中听写文本。文本转语音引擎完全是本地,因此它不需要网络连接即可使用。...另一个巧妙技巧:你可以通过按 Ctrl-Shift-L 在所选文本每个实例中插入光标。你还可以通过按 Shift-Alt 和左右箭头来控制多个光标的选择大小。...默认情况下,没有为这些行为分配任何键绑定,但您可以从命令面板中访问它们(键入“只读”以搜索它们)并根据需要分配键。 将文件标记为只读以进行会话可以防止意外修改不应更改关键配置数据。...Python 项目需要与 Java 或 C# 项目不同自定义设置。为此,VS Code 允许您使用 配置文件(Profile) 将各种自定义设置组合在一起,并将其保存在一个通用名称下。...您可以通过配置文件修改和保存设置、键盘快捷键、用户代码段和任务以及扩展,并且可以与队友共享您配置文件以保持工作流同步。 配置文件可用于存储和共享针对每个工作流或语言自定义设置组。

11310

20个vscode快捷键,让编码快如闪电

在Windows上:Shift + Alt +上/下 在Mac上:Shift + Option +上/下 在Ubuntu上:Ctrl + Shift + Alt +上/下 另外,你还可以通过选择以下内容来查看关联按键绑定...:文件>首选项>键盘快捷键,然后根据你选择编辑绑定。...拆分编辑器原始键盘快捷键是123。在并行编辑时很有用。 另外,你还可以通过选择以下内容来查看关联绑定:文件>首选项>键盘快捷键,然后根据你选择编辑绑定。...VS代码一项特色功能,可以节省你最多时间。...请参阅键盘参考命令 所有命令都在命令面板中,带有关联绑定(如果存在)。如果你忘记了键盘快捷键,请使用“命令面板”来帮助你。 ?

2.1K20

提高生产力10个必备VS Code技巧和窍门

代码美化:一键格式化 快捷键Shift + Alt + F可以快速格式化代码,与Prettier等扩展配合使用效果更佳。...所以,当你在保存文件时,VS Code会自动使用当前默认格式化程序对你代码进行格式化,就像你在上面的演示中看到那样。 当你进行自动保存时,每隔一段时间都要打开命令面板来进行格式化会变得很繁琐。...这就是键盘快捷键用途所在: Windows:Shift + Alt + F Mac:Shift + Option + F Linux:Ctrl + Shift + I 我使用是Windows系统,个人不太喜欢这个默认键盘快捷键...;自动保存功能让我不得不时不时地进行格式化,Shift + Alt + F这个组合久了也会让人感到痛苦。...所以我把它改成了 Ctrl + D, Ctrl + D - 一个更容易按下和记住键盘快捷键组合,并且没有冲突按键绑定。我建议你也这样做。 9.

25820

解放生产力!20 个必知必会 VSCode 小技巧

所以我会列出我最喜欢可以使我快速开发快捷键。 let's start! 1....这样一来,你就可以添加一个设置,不是直接修改默认设置。 4)保存用户设置文件。 我们也可以绑定一个快捷键去手动触发空格清除(快捷键面板里 Trim Trailing Whitespace)。...如果你使用了新版本 VS Code ,那么按照步骤一,然后看下面的图片。 4. 折叠代码 有时候如果代码很多,并且你只想整体了解下,那么折叠代码就会很有用。...+ Shift + Alt + Up/Down 而且,你可以通过 File > Preferences > Keyboard Shortcuts 查看绑定快捷键,然后绑定到你喜欢快捷键上 6....2)查看键盘绑定命令 所有的命令以及绑定快捷键都在命令面板里。如你忘记了某个快捷键,它可以帮助到你。

6K24

分享10个必备VS Code技巧和窍门,提高你开发效率

所以,当你在保存文件时,VS Code会自动使用当前默认格式化程序对你代码进行格式化,就像你在上面的演示中看到那样。 当你进行自动保存时,每隔一段时间都要打开命令面板来进行格式化会变得很繁琐。...这就是键盘快捷键用途所在: Windows: Shift + Alt + F Mac: Shift + Option + F Linux: Ctrl + Shift + I 我使用是Windows系统...,个人而言,我不喜欢这个默认键盘快捷键;自动保存让我不时需要重新格式化,Shift + Alt + F久了也变得非常痛苦。...所以我将其更改为 Ctrl + D, Ctrl + D - 一个更容易按下和记住键盘快捷键组合,并且没有冲突按键绑定。我建议你也这样做。 9....,一个在上方,一个在下方 在Windows/Mac中,使用Alt/Option + 上/下键将一行向上或向下移动 通过双击资源管理器窗格创建一个新文件,或者设置一个自定义键盘快捷键。

38820

16个VS Code快捷方式,可加快编码速度

介绍 微软VS Code是互联网上最受欢迎文本/代码编辑器之一。VS Code是一个IDE(集成开发环境),我们可以通过使用扩展使其功能更强大,并且非常易于自定义。...今天,我们将研究VS代码快捷方式,这些快捷方式将帮助您更有效地进行编码。 键盘快捷键 1.命令面板 键盘快捷键: Ctrl+Shift+P 根据您的当前上下文访问所有可用命令。...所有命令都在命令面板中,带有关联绑定(如果存在)。如果您忘记了键盘快捷键,请使用“命令面板”来帮助您。 2.快速打开 键盘快捷键: Ctrl+P 快速打开文件。...11.复制上/下一行 键盘快捷键:Shift+Alt+Up或Shift+Alt+Down 复制整行并将其粘贴到上方或下方行中。...13.代码格式 当前选择代码: Ctrl+K Ctrl+F 整个文件格式: Shift+Alt+F 格式化不整洁代码以清理代码以提高可读性。

94330

VS Code常用快捷键

1、编辑器与窗口管理 新建文件: Ctrl+N 文件之间切换: Ctrl+Tab 打开一个新VS Code编辑器: Ctrl+Shift+N 关闭当前窗口: Ctrl+W...关闭当前VS Code编辑器: Ctrl+Shift+W 切出一个新编辑器窗口(最多3个): Ctrl+\ 切换左中右3个编辑器窗口快捷键: Ctrl+1 Ctrl+2 Ctrl...: Ctrl+Home 移动到定义处: F12 查看定义处缩略图(只看一眼不跳转过去): Alt+F12 选择从光标到行尾内容: Shift+End 选择从光标到行首内容...三、修改默认快捷键 打开默认键盘快捷方式设置:File -> Preferences -> Keyboard Shortcuts( 中文界面时:“文件”->“首选项”->“键盘快捷方式”),或者:Alt...编写对应规则有一定方法,如下所示: // 将键绑定放入此文件中以覆盖默认值 [{ "key": "f8", "command": "workbench.action.tasks.runTask

71130

高效编码:我VS Code设置

今天,我将分享我最喜欢代码编辑器设置,用于我 Web 开发。我将从代码编辑器外观开始。毕竟外观颜值很重要。 ?...您要使用我设置,使用我 VS Code 字体吗?在 VS Code 中,按 Ctrl + P,输入 settings.json 并打开该文件。现在,给定值替换下面的属性值。...Settings Sync 使用 GitHub Gist 在多台机器上同步设置,代码片段,主题,文件图标,启动,键绑定,工作区和扩展。...VS Code 快捷键 我在日常生活中使用了一些重要键盘快捷键,这些快捷方式使 Visual Studio Code 提高了我工作效率。...:触发建议 Shift + Alt + Down:向下复制行 Shift + Alt + Up:向上复制行 Ctrl + Shift + T:重新打开最新关闭窗口 感谢您阅读和关注。

1.7K10

14个你必须要知道ubuntu快捷键

注意:Linux 中 Super 键即键盘上带有 Windows 图标的键,本文中我使用了大写字母,但这不代表你需要按下 shift 键,比如,T 代表键盘 ‘t’ 键,不代表 Shift+t。...如果要从右向左移动,可使用 Super+Shift+Tab 快捷键。 在这里您也可以 Alt 键代替 Super 键。...Alt+F4 是关闭应用程序窗口更“通用”快捷方式。 它不适用于一些应用程序,如 Ubuntu 中默认终端。...在 Ubuntu 中使用自定义键盘快捷键 14 、DIY 快捷键 您不是只能使用默认键盘快捷键,您可以根据需要创建自己自定义键盘快捷键。...转到“设置->设备->键盘”,您将在这里看到系统所有键盘快捷键。向下滚动到底部,您将看到“自定义快捷方式”选项。 您需要提供易于识别的快捷键名称、使用快捷键时运行命令,以及您自定义按键组合

4.1K00

ubuntu实用快捷键

注意:Linux 中 Super 键即键盘上带有 Windows 图标的键,本文中我使用了大写字母,但这不代表你需要按下 shift 键,比如,T 代表键盘 ‘t’ 键,不代表 Shift+t。...如果要从右向左移动,可使用 Super+Shift+Tab 快捷键。 在这里您也可以 Alt 键代替 Super 键。...Alt+F4 是关闭应用程序窗口更“通用”快捷方式。 它不适用于一些应用程序,如 Ubuntu 中默认终端。...在 Ubuntu 中使用自定义键盘快捷键 14 、DIY 快捷键 您不是只能使用默认键盘快捷键,您可以根据需要创建自己自定义键盘快捷键。...转到“设置->设备->键盘”,您将在这里看到系统所有键盘快捷键。向下滚动到底部,您将看到“自定义快捷方式”选项。 您需要提供易于识别的快捷键名称、使用快捷键时运行命令,以及您自定义按键组合

1.9K10

【建议收藏】面试官贼喜欢问 32+ vue 修饰符,你掌握几种啦?

-- 滚动事件默认行为 (即滚动行为) 将会立即触发 --> <!...第三个输入框类型是number,最后得到值也是number number.gif 系统修饰符 当点击事件或者键盘事件需要系统键同时按下才触发时.ctrl、.alt、.shift、.meta可以帮大忙噢...如下代码 全局监听keydown事件,尝试看.ctrl、.alt、.shift、.meta是否被按下 分别给四个按钮加上 .ctrl、.alt、.shift、.meta修饰符并配合点击事件,验证是否同时按下指定按键...,详细例子请看上面 18 .alt 仅在按下alt按键时才触发鼠标或键盘事件监听器,详细例子请看上面 19 .shift 仅在按下shift按键时才触发鼠标或键盘事件监听器,详细例子请看上面 20...在按下(fn + up)按键时才触发鼠标或键盘事件监听器,详细例子请看上面 如何自定义按键修饰符 vue本身给我们内置了很多实用按键修饰符,大部分情况下可以满足我们日常需求了,那么有没有办法可以自定义按键修饰符呢

2.6K10

玩转 Windows Terminal

color schemes放在这里 42 "schemes": [ 43 44 ], 45 46 // 在下面的集合中添加自定义按键命令绑定 47 // 取消组合键,请将命令设置为.../ 按组合Alt+Shift+D 打开一个新窗格,注意不是标签 70 //-“ split”:“ auto”使此窗格向着能提供最大面积方向打开。...按住alt键, 再去点击设置选项,这时不会打开setting.json, 而是会打开一个名为default.json文件,这就是默认配置文件。 代码如下,做了折叠有兴趣可以看一看。...这也使我们简单了解了"profiles"配置方式。我们可以像配置配色方案一样配置其他属性。例如可以通过如下代码默认背景颜色设置成红色(挺丑)。...不只是样式,还可以设置光标、键盘、tab标题等,这里就不一一介绍了,详见本文底部官方链接。 3. 自定义colorScheme 本节我们自定义一个colorScheme。

1.2K20
领券